Radical cure for falciparum malaria in co-endemic areas
Purpose:

In areas co-endemic for the two main species of malaria P.falciparum and P.vivax, Primaquine the only drug currently available to treat the dormant liver forms of P. vivax malaria and therefore reduce relapses is only used in patients presenting with acute vivax malaria. However there is mounting evidence that P. falciparum infection increases the risk of P. vivax relapse. Therefore we propose to assess the benefit of administering Primaquine to patients with P. falciparum mono-infection.
